Transaction cd73756bda7149e12697685f1e60634d2cb61f855fcf07f93dbaabcad38f1ba2
1 Input
1 Output
-
cd73756bda7149e12697685f1e60634d2cb61f855fcf07f93dbaabcad38f1ba2:0
- value
- 3328441
- script pubkey
- OP_0 OP_PUSHBYTES_20 51a63439678181c6463f7aea23fa2d5242370efa
- address
- bc1q2xnrgwt8sxquv33l0t4z873d2fprwrh62hwsua